The Willard is a small pocket in Pompano Beach, and the honest starting point is that the current MLS snapshot is thin. There is no median price, no inventory count, and no amenity set to anchor a data-driven read, so anyone pricing here should treat each listing as its own negotiation rather than leaning on a comp-rich pattern.

In a market this quiet on data, condition and location within the community do most of the work on price. For a seller, that means the presentation of the individual home carries more weight than any neighborhood-wide trend line. For a buyer, it means slow, deliberate diligence beats assuming there is a going rate.

If we were buying in The Willard today, this is the order of operations we would run for our clients.

1

Underwrite the condition first. Price the roof, HVAC, and systems honestly before judging any list price; condition swings value here more than square footage alone.

2

Match the home to real comps. Recent sales of similar condition and lot, not the asking price, tell you what a home is worth.

3

Move deliberately, not desperately. Neither side has a decisive edge, so a well-prepared, fairly-priced offer wins without overpaying.

4

Line up financing and inspection early. A pre-approval and an inspection plan let you act fast and negotiate from evidence.

5

Keep an agent in your corner. The listing agent works for the seller; we represent you and prepare a hand-built valuation before any offer in The Willard.

A thin-data pocket in Pompano Beach

No community amenities surfaced from current MLS listings, which tells you what The Willard is not: it is not a package deal of pools, gates, or clubhouses. What you are buying is proximity to the Pompano Beach coast and whatever the specific property offers on its own lot.

Because the canonical snapshot carries no price or volume figures, we would not quote you a range you can bank on. The right move is to underwrite each home directly, weigh its condition, and lean on hyperlocal comparables pulled at the time you transact rather than any static neighborhood average.
